Kobe is perhaps the greatest clutch player ever.....
Okay, let's look at the numbers (updated as of April 1 of 2015) instead of lazy rhetoric pushed by talking heads on ESPN.
Regular Season; a shot to tie or take the lead
Last 24 seconds
Kobe: 48 for 165 (29.1%)
LeBron: 29 for 99 (29.3%)
Last 30 seconds
Kobe (since 01): 54 for 176 (30.68%)
LeBron: 33 for 108 (30.56%)
Last 2 minutes
Kobe (since 01): 130 for 346 (37.57%)
LeBron: 89 for 227 (39.21%)
Last 5 minutes
Kobe (since 2001 season): 243 for 586 (41.47%)
LeBron (since 04 season): 189 for 434 (43.55%)
Post Season; a shot to tie or take the lead
Last 24 seconds
Kobe: 7 for 28 (25.0%)
LeBron: 7 for 17 (41.1%)
Last 30 seconds
Kobe: 7 for 28 (25.0%) (0 for 8 from the 09 post season till present day)
LeBron: 9 for 19 (47.30%)
Last 2 minutes
Kobe: 17 for 50 (34%) (0 for 8 in the last two playoffs; 2010 and 2011)
LeBron: 21 for 43 (48.8%)
Last 5 minutes
Kobe (since 01 season): 30 for 88 (34.09%)
LeBron: (since 06 season): 36 for 74 (48.6%)
https://swishnba.files.wordpress.com/2013/10/bwtxfczcmae-dec-large.png
Kobe is actually pretty bad "in the clutch. He just takes so many of them that his fans selectively remember the ones he makes.
